At its Oct. 20 meeting the Muscatine County Board of Supervisors set a public hearing for an engineer zoning office building project, approved a culvert construction contract, accepted the county weed commissioner's 2025 report and confirmed two appointments to the county Compensation Commission.

Muscatine County Board of Supervisors on Monday, Oct. 20, 2025, approved several routine and project-specific items, including setting a public hearing for the county engineer zoning office building project, awarding a culvert contract, accepting the 2025 weed commissioner's report and confirming two appointments to the Muscatine County Compensation Commission.

The board voted to set a public hearing for Monday, Oct. 27, 2025, at 9 a.m. on "proposed plans, specifications, form of contract, and cost estimate for the Muscatine County Engineer Zoning Office Building Project." The board directed that the plans be made available for public review ahead of the hearing. A motion to set the hearing was made and seconded and carried by voice vote.
